Noun

1.
medicalTECH.image produced by ultrasoundTECH.
  • The doctor examined the sonogram to check the baby's health.
echogram ultrasound
2.
audioTECH.USthree-dimensional representation of a sound signalTECH.US
  • The sonogram illustrated the sound's frequency and intensity.

Origin of sonogram

Greek, sonos (sound) + gramma (something written)
